THANK YOU FOR CARING GIVE BLOOD ' - Hi M I Pi i *itr k Cheryl Faye Stallings m Esther Dale Adams JOeanut 'Tutival 7eatutes Sallet (stoup The Virginia Beach Community Ballet will again appear in Edenton during Peanut Festival. This group of young dancers has recently appeared at the Debra Ann Alons I&hHb * Deborah Kay Suter Azalea Festival and has given two major per formances at the Virginia Beach Pavillion. One of the senior dancers is Andrea Rankins, grandaughter of _______ Debbie Lynn Jordan Donna Patricia Elliott Earl and Elizabeth Long of Edenton. Several works will be performed on October 2 at 11:30 A.M. in the Holmes Auditorium. Among them are “Company Audition”, a “pas de deux”, a jazz number and a featured solo. On September 24, Virginia Beach Community Ballet will be the featured com pany at the First Annual Virginia Beach Dance Festival to be held in the Kempsville Recreation Center. Come and spend an en joyable hour with the dance in the Holmes Auditorium, 11:30 A.M., October 2, immediately after the Peanut Festival parade. Registration for lessions will be on Monday nights September 20 and 27 at 8 P.M. at the Edenton J.C. building. For further in formation call 482 - 3986 or 793 - 4500. Like to hunt and fish? The N.C. Wildlife Resources Commission has over two million acres of public hunting and fishing areas enrolled in its Game Lands Program. All a sportsman needs to use these areas is a sportsman’s license, or a hunting or fishing license and game-lands use permit.
